Abstract

Based on data from the Cancer Hospital Dharmais (RSKD), from 2004 to 2010, breast cancer was always the top ranked. It showed that breast cancer is a serious disease in Indonesia. Psychological reactions that usually appear after a patient adjudged breast cancer is a mental shock, anxiety, could not accept the fact, to depression. Anxiety that occurs in patients with breast cancer will be reduced if the immediate environment, such as family, relatives, friends, and neighbors provide social support to the patient. This study aims to examine the relationship between social support with anxiety in breast cancer patients. This study involved 30 breast cancer patients with stage II and III age range 17-60 years. It was based on the assumption that patients in stage II and III may exhibit anxiety traits and still possible to join the study, and patients with an age range 17-60 years has had psychological maturity and be able to think logically. This research used quantitative methods using scale study, which was based on indicators which refer to the theory of social support by Sarafino (1998) and the theory of anxiety by Nevid (2005). The results of this study indicate that there was an association between social support with anxiety in breast cancer patients.Keywords: Breast cancer patients, social support, and anxiety

Abstract

Mother stopped working, and chose to become a housewife as may be necessary to adjust themselves well, such as nurturing and caring for the child, completing household chores well, and socialize with the environment around the house. Adjustment is done well will be associated with the formation of a good self esteem. This study aims to determine the relationship between self-esteem with the adjustment to the role of a housewife mother stopped working in Jakarta. The sampling technique in this research using accidental sampling technique by taking the subject as much as 70 housewives in Jakarta. Data analysis techniques used in this study is the Pearson Product Moment Correlation technique. The results of this study indicate that there is a significant positive relationship between self-esteem with the adjustment to the role of a housewife mother stopped working in Jakarta, (r = 0.608, p = 0.000). It can be said that the higher the mother's self-esteem, the better the ability to adjust himself to be a housewife. Conversely, the lower the mother's self-esteem, the worse the ability to adjust himself to be a housewife. Keywords: Self Esteem, Adjustment, Housewife, Mother Stopped Working

Abstract

Excess or lack of weight has a negative risk in children. Cross-sectional study in 3227 parents who have 5-6 years old children showed that children who have excess or lack of weight can have quality of life disorders related to physical health problems. The results of research conducted by Tapper also found that attitudes towards breakfast habits become behavioral predictions breakfast. But it turns out in fact that it is not always proven. Therefore, researchers wanted to see whether attitudes towards breakfast habits have a correlation with the level of a person's weight or not. This research used a correlation type. Participants in this study were 127 students of SD "X" in East Jakarta. Sample selection techniques used in this study was judgmental sampling. Its measurement using a scale of attitudes towards breakfast habits, adaptation of the questionnaire from Tapper, consisting of 13 items. The results of the present study was, calculate the value of r acquired (0.082), then it can be concluded that there was no correlation between attitudes towards breakfast habits with body weight levels in elementary school children.Keywords: Attitude, Breakfast, Body Weight
